Is Cheesecake Factory vegan?

The Cheesecake Factory has limited vegan options, but they do offer filling vegan entrees that can be paired with vegan salads, sides, or appetizers. The restaurant also has a selection of vegetable sides on the menu, though customers should note that they may come with butter added by default.

Does the Cheesecake Factory serve desserts?

Yes, The Cheesecake Factory does serve desserts, but none of their non-cheesecake options are vegan. However, fresh strawberries without cream are available as a vegan-friendly option.

Does Cheesecake Factory Bread contain milk?

The bread served at Cheesecake Factory restaurants contains milk. However, some of their bread products sold in grocery stores may be made without milk but with a different recipe. Customers are advised to check with the server for any potential dairy-free options available.

What kind of ice cream does The Cheesecake Factory serve?

The Cheesecake Factory serves Edy's or Dreyer's vanilla ice cream in most of their US locations, according to the executive pastry chef.

Does the Cheesecake Factory have vegetarian food?

The Cheesecake Factory does not have a separate vegetarian menu, but they are able to modify most dishes to be made without meat products. Some suggested items include pizza without eggs, quesadillas without chicken, avocado eggrolls (sealed with egg wash), and sweet corn tamale cakes.

When was the first Cheesecake Factory opened?

The first Cheesecake Factory restaurant was opened in 1978 in Beverly Hills, California. This event marked the culmination of years of hard work and dedication by the Overton family, who had come a long way from their humble beginnings of baking cheesecakes in Evelyn's basement. David Overton, Evelyn's son, was the driving force behind the establishment of the restaurant.

Who started Evelyn's Cheesecake Factory bakery?

The Cheesecake Factory Bakery was started by a family using their last savings to sell Evelyn's cheesecakes to restaurants in Los Angeles. Eventually, their son David opened a restaurant in Beverly Hills to showcase the desserts.
